Week 3: 2022 Illinois High School Football Top 10 Poll
Catch up on the 2022 Week 3 rankings of Illinois high school football teams in each class before tonight's games.


Here are the latest rankings of Illinois high school football teams in each class, according to an Associated Press panel of sportswriters:
Class 8A
School | Record | Points | Prv |
---|---|---|---|
1. Loyola (11) | 3-0 | 110 | 1 |
2. Lincoln-Way East (1) | 3-0 | 98 | 2 |
3. Gurnee Warren | 3-0 | 81 | 4 |
4. Glenbard West | 3-0 | 78 | 3 |
5. Naperville North | 3-0 | 57 | 5 |
6. O'Fallon | 3-0 | 48 | 6 |
7. Maine South | 2-1 | 35 | 7 |
8. Marist (Chicago) | 2-1 | 23 | 8 |
9. Edwardsville | 3-0 | 15 | 9 |
10. Lockport | 3-0 | 14 | NR |
Others receiving votes: York 13, Bolingbrook 10, Glenbard East 7, Palatine 7, Glenbrook South 4, Lyons 3, South Elgin 1, Naperville Neuqua Valley 1.
